UCL: Why Arsenal Beat Sporting, Says Arteta

Kai Havertz scored in the 91st minute, as the Gunners returned to England with a narrow win in their Champions League quarter-final first leg.

Arsenal manager Mikel Arteta has admitted that at one point, he didn’t expect his team to score in their 1-0 win over Sporting on Tuesday.

Kai Havertz scored in the 91st minute, as the Gunners returned to England with a narrow win in their Champions League quarter-final first leg.

David Raya pulled out several fantastic saves, while Martin Zubimendi’s effort was chalked off for offside.

Arteta has now said his players missed sharpness in the final third.

On whether he thought his side might not score tonight, Arteta said: “Yes, because when we got into the final third and we sat there we missed the final bit.

“We had to be a little bit crisper, faster, more efficient to break them down when they had that block.

“We had a goal disallowed and there were two or three occasions where we were close but we lacked that final pass.

“In the end, a magic moment from the finishers win us the game.”
